Welcome to Passau, the charming "City of Three Rivers". This stopover invites you to explore its rich cultural and architectural heritage. Stroll through the picturesque streets of the Old Town, where the magnificent St. Stephen's Cathedral stands, home to one of the world's largest organs. Discover the confluence of three rivers - the Danube, the Inn and the Ilz - offering a stunning natural spectacle. Enjoy cosy cafés and local craft stores. Passau's history is revealed through its museums and historic buildings, promising an enriching cultural experience.

Vienna, the Austrian capital, is a cultural and historical jewel. Stroll its elegant streets, soak up the Baroque architecture and discover priceless art treasures. Schönbrunn Palace, with its sumptuous gardens, is a must-see. Classical music is omnipresent, inviting you to enjoy a concert in one of the city's prestigious opera houses. Viennese cafés, with their delicious pastries and unique ambience, are perfect for a gourmet break. Vienna, combining history, art and gastronomy, promises a fascinating stopover for lovers of European culture and elegance.

Solt, located in Hungary's Southern Great Plain, is a peaceful river port on the Danube. Visitors can visit St. Mary's Catholic Church and the Reformed Church, a testament to the local religious heritage. The region is also famous for its culinary specialties, such as gulyás, a spicy beef soup, and lángos, a fried pancake filled with cream and cheese.

Mohács in Hungary is famous for its historic role in the Battle of Mohács and its annual carnival, the Busójárás,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Visit the Battle Museum to learn more about local history. The carnival, with its traditional masks and festivities, is a unique cultural experience. The town is also a starting point for exploring the beautiful Baranya region, with its vineyards and nature.

Belgrade, Serbia's vibrant capital, combines history, culture and nightlife. Explore the Kalemegdan fortress, stroll along the pedestrian street of Knez Mihailova, and discover the atmosphere of the banks of the Sava. The city offers a captivating mix of Ottoman, Austro-Hungarian and modern architecture. The local cuisine, with its grills and pastries, is a delight. Belgrade is ideal for those seeking a rich and diverse urban experience.

Rousse, Bulgaria's main river port on the Danube, is nicknamed "Little Vienna" because of its neoclassical and Art Nouveau architecture. Visitors can explore the well-preserved old town, admire Freedom Square with its Freedom Monument, and visit the Dohodno Zdanie Theater. The regional history museum, housed in the former Battenberg Palace, features archaeological and ethnographic collections. Local specialties include Danube fish dishes and "banitsa", a traditional puff pastry.

Cernavoda, Romania, is a gateway to the rich heritage of the Danube. This tranquil town is an ideal base for exploring the surrounding area, including the famous Histria fortress and the Danube Delta nature reserve. Cruisers can soak up the local history, stroll along the peaceful quays and sample traditional Romanian cuisine. Cernavoda is a charming stopover for those wishing to discover a unique blend of nature and history.

Giurgiu, Romania, located on the banks of the Danube, is a historic town worth discovering. Visit the Giurgiu fortress, testimony to its medieval past. Stroll along the waterfront for picturesque views of the river and the Bulgarian town of Ruse opposite. Explore the town's Orthodox churches and parks. Enjoy the local cuisine, rich in Ottoman and Balkan influences. Giurgiu is an interesting stopover for those interested in Balkan history and culture.

Novi Sad, Serbia, is a vibrant city rich in history and culture. Known for the EXIT festival, one of the biggest music festivals in Europe, the city attracts visitors from all over the world. Its city center, with the Petrovaradin fortress and charming cobblestone streets, offers a harmonious blend of historic architecture and modern urban life. Novi Sad is also a cultural center, with numerous museums, art galleries and a diverse culinary scene.

Aljmaš, a Croatian village at the confluence of the Danube and Drava rivers, is a popular stop on river cruises. Visitors can explore the Marian shrine, an important place of pilgrimage, and enjoy walks along the banks with panoramic views of the waterways. The region is also renowned for its traditional cuisine, including freshwater fish dishes such as grilled carp and paprikaš, a spicy stew.

Hungary's capital, Budapest, is famous for its thermal baths and impressive architecture. Visit Parliament, Buda Castle and the Chain Bridge. Cruisers can relax in the famous Széchenyi or Gellért baths. The city offers delicious cuisine, with specialties such as goulash. Budapest is a rewarding stopover for lovers of history, culture and well-being.

Bratislava, the capital of Slovakia, blends medieval architecture, castles and a modern cultural life. Explore the Old Town, visit Bratislava Castle and enjoy views of the Danube. The city offers a varied gastronomy and a dynamic art scene. Bratislava is perfect for an enriching urban experience in Central Europe.

Weißenkirchen in der Wachau, located on the north bank of the Danube in Lower Austria, is a wine-growing village in the heart of a UNESCO World Heritage landscape. Visitors can explore the 14th-century Gothic fortified church with its covered wooden staircase and the Teisenhoferhof, a Renaissance complex housing the Wachau Museum. The surrounding footpaths offer panoramic views of the terraced vineyards. The region is famous for its white wines, especially Riesling, and specialties made from Wachau apricots, such as Marillenknödel.
